Beef Empire Days 2009

Beef Empire Days celebrates an industry that has a long history of contributing to the economic well-being of southwest Kansas while providing quality beef to the state, the nation and the world. Salute the beef industry with events that will entertain young and old alike, from parades to the PRCA rodeo.
